Hello we have a few questions about being diamond:

 

1- Do you get discount for the voom package on the Oasis class ships? If so, do we purchase before the cruise or on the ship?

 

2- I assume the diamond club on the Oasis has complimentary drinks, is this is a full or. limited bar?

 

3- If we get a drink in the diamond club, can we walk out with it?

 

4- Is it true, we will receive three complimentary drinks on our sea pass that we can use at bars excluding the rise n tide bar?

 

5- Is the breakfast just continental or full breakfast and what time is it served to?

 

6- Any other benefits I am missing as a diamond member?

Link to comment
Share on other sites

The VOOM discount is available on all ships for purchases made onboard.

 

Diamond lounge has the same drink restrictions as on other ships.

 

They don't care much anymore if you walk out with one drink.

 

You get 3 drink vouchers than can be used at virtually all bars, but there may be a bar or two that does not participate.

 

Continental breakfast only.

 

Details will be in a letter you will receive ion your stateroom.

I've also read on these boards that the Diamond drink benefit isn't available on Rising Tide, but we've not personally experienced it - we've never had a problem using our drink vouchers on either Oasis or Allure.

 

The cappuccino machine in the Lounge has been one of our favorite perks (when it's working), and the Lounge can be a quiet place to relax during the day as well.

The restriction on using the vouchers on the Rising Tide Bar was introduced on the Harmony. Oasis & Allure still allow it.

 

The rising tides bar was brought up and I guess this is related. Does one have to purchase an alcoholic beverage to sit there and ride it up/down to check it out?

 

Nope. Ride away!
